How do you monitor AWS resources and applications?

Monitoring your AWS resources and applications is essential to ensure that they are performing optimally and to detect and diagnose any issues that may arise. Here are some ways to monitor your AWS resources and applications:

AWS CloudWatch: CloudWatch is a monitoring service that provides metrics, logs, and alarms for AWS resources and applications. You can use CloudWatch to monitor EC2 instances, EBS volumes, RDS databases, and other AWS services. CloudWatch also provides insights into resource utilization, application performance, and system behavior.

AWS CloudTrail: CloudTrail is a logging service that records API calls made by AWS services and resources. You can use CloudTrail to monitor activity on your AWS account, including changes to resources and access to them.

AWS X-Ray: X-Ray is a debugging and tracing service that helps you identify and diagnose issues with your applications. X-Ray provides a visual representation of your application’s components and their dependencies, and can help you pinpoint the root cause of issues.

AWS Config: Config is a configuration management service that provides a detailed inventory of your AWS resources and their configuration settings. Config can help you track changes to your resources and ensure compliance with organizational policies.

Third-Party Tools: There are also many third-party monitoring and logging tools available for AWS, such as New Relic, Datadog, and Splunk.

By using these tools, you can monitor the performance and health of your AWS resources and applications, identify and troubleshoot issues, and ensure that your applications are running optimally.

Leave a Comment

Your email address will not be published. Required fields are marked *

wpChatIcon
wpChatIcon